vmware17怎么下载ros
时间: 2025-01-02 17:29:19 浏览: 8
### 如何在 VMware 17 上下载并安装 ROS (Robot Operating System)
#### 准备工作
为了确保顺利安装,在开始之前需确认已准备好以下事项:
- 已经成功安装了 VMware Workstation Player 或 Pro 17 并正常启动。
- 获取 Ubuntu ISO 文件,建议使用长期支持版本如 Ubuntu 20.04 LTS。
#### 创建虚拟机环境
创建新的虚拟机来承载即将安装的操作系统。通过导入现有的 ISO 镜像文件或是从网络引导的方式都可以实现这一目标[^3]。
```bash
# 启动VMware后点击“Create a New Virtual Machine”
# 按照向导提示选择ISO镜像位置以及分配磁盘空间大小等参数设置
```
#### 安装操作系统
按照常规流程完成操作系统的安装过程。对于 Ubuntu 来说,默认选项通常已经足够满足需求。值得注意的是,如果遇到分辨率不匹配等问题可以尝试调整显示配置直至恢复正常。
#### 更新软件源
进入新建立好的 Ubuntu 虚拟环境中执行更新命令以获取最新的软件包列表信息。
```bash
sudo apt update && sudo apt upgrade -y
```
#### 安装 ROS Noetic
针对 Ubuntu 20.04 推荐安装 ROS Noetic 版本。具体步骤如下所示:
##### 设置密钥与仓库地址
```bash
sudo sh -c 'echo "deb http://packages.ros.org/ros/ubuntu $(lsb_release -sc) main" > /etc/apt/sources.list.d/ros-latest.list'
sudo ap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v-keys C1CF6E31E6BADE8868B172B4F42ED6FBAB17C654
```
##### 执行安装指令
```bash
sudo apt-get install ros-noetic-desktop-full
```
##### 初始化 `rosdep` 和依赖项同步
```bash
sudo rosdep init
rosdep update
```
##### 添加 ROS 环境变量至 `.bashrc`
```bash
echo "source /opt/ros/noetic/setup.bash" >> ~/.bashrc
source ~/.bashrc
```
##### 测试安装成果
验证是否能够正常使用 roscore 命令开启核心节点服务。
```bash
roscore &
```
阅读全文